About 1 1/2 years ago or so I began to notice that I was always getting razor burn on the sides of my upper lip and on the sides of my chin just below my mouth on either side. I tried all kinds of lotions, after shaves and different cartridge disposable razors, and while some helped it never went completely away and would irritate me even a day later.
I had come to the understanding that my skin had become more sensitive as I had gotten older.
So after some reading and talking with my barber, I decided to try going to an "old fashioned" double edge like my dad used many years ago. I was a little trepidatious, because the last time I used his razor (in like 1979), I came away looking like I had been in a slasher film.
After a lot of looking at the available DE razors, I decided on the long handled Vikings Blade "Vulcan", because it seemed like the best fit going by the other reviews and also because it would come with their more mild blade that is recommended for beginners.
One side note here: I like a company that has confidence in their product and Vikings Blade even recommends two of their competitor's razor blades for when you are ready for a more aggressive blade.
That's confidence!
I also ordered the Vikings Blade "White Knight" shave brush.
So far here is the review;
I showered first and then rubbed some pre-shave oil on my face. I whipped up my Poraso shave soap with my White Knight brush. it went on pretty much the same as I have seen in videos, so I reached for the razor.
I have been practicing the 30 degree angle with my disposable for a few days so I went with what seemed a pretty good angle (with no pressure and the razor resting on my face) I went through my first pass (downward strokes) allowing the weight of the razor to do the work, noting a few tugs, but no grabs and overall it went pretty smooth, and most importantly no nicks or cuts or irritation.
I re-lathered and went for the second pass (horizontal strokes, from ears to mouth direction)and it was also going very well until I had one small nick in one of my trouble areas. I finished my neck very carefully and then felt my progress and went for the third pass (upward against the grain). In the end I had the one small nick (I attribute it to needing more practice with the razor), but otherwise the shave was great. My face felt great and I did not need another shave for two days, with almost no stubble during that time.
Best of all, Even with that, I had absolutely no razor burn at all. If you see some reddish area in my pic, that is leftover from my shave 2 days before.
So when it comes to recommendations I would absolutely say that the Vikings Blade "Vulcan" razor and the "White Knight" brush are both top notch and met all of my expectations. I would also recommend the Poraso shave soap and the Cremo Post Shave Balm. It was very cooling and had a nice scent at a reasonable cost.
As far as the VB mild razors...so far so good, they are very good for practice, but I will be ordering a variety pack of razors so that I can try out different brands and hone in on the one that will suit me best.
Best of luck with your shaving experiences and remember...
Don'T PreSS on The RazoR!!

I look at several brands on Amazon and landed on Vikings because frankly I liked the look and I like Vikings. I bought the Vikings Stand, bowl and Brush. At first, I was a little disappointed by the blade. Thus I wanted to try Merkur 23c which is the highest reviewed DE on Amazon. I thought that maybe the Vikings DE was just inferior. But ultimately I came to love the Vikings more than the Merkur and I sent it back. This review will compare the two against each other.
For the purpose of this review, I want to state that I used Merkur's blades in both the Vikings DE and Merkur. Astra, Feather, and Merkur just make better blades than Vikings, maybe that will change in the future, but for now, to the strongest goes my money. I use Taylor of Old Bond Steet Sandalwood shaving cream, lather, and wood preshave oil and post shave balm. The first thing you will notice when you compare the Vulcan with the Merker 23c, is that the Vulcan is much much bigger and a lot heavier than the Merker. This is a real plus for me, it makes it a lot easier to shave because you don't have to put much pressure on the blade. You let the weight of the Vulcan do it for you. This is a clear winning feature.
Another really important feature that places the Vulcan over the Merkur 23c at least is the butterfly feature. On the Vulcan DE, to change the blade all you have to do is unscrew the bottom and the head of the razor opens up. It takes not 5 seconds to change a blade. Merkur 23c is three pieces, and no matter how many videos I watched or my technique it is not easy to change the blade. DE blades are far sharper than anything most people touch. I gave myself quite the cut changing Merkur 23c and that hurt for a solid week. With the butterfly head, you just don't have the same risk.
Finally, for the most important part, how well it shaves. I want to state that the Merkur gives a good shave, especially for a beginner. But the Vulcan DE wins out for me because it is the more aggressive shave. IF you compare the Vulcan with the Merkur, you will notice that the Merkur has a lot longer guard. The great thing about is that it makes it much harder to cut or nick yourself. There is a lot less gap between the blade and the guard. Whereas with the Vulcan, the guard is much shorter and the gap is much bigger. This leaves the blade much more exposed and a lot closer shave. I would often find myself shaving first with the Merkur and unable to get a close shave. Whereas you could just to finish up with the Vulcan and catch what the Merkur missed.
In summary, both the Vikings Vulcan and Merkur 23c are good razors. But I like a more aggressive shave that makes my face as smooth as a baby's ass. So if you are a beginner and aren't' willing to try something like the Muhle R41 which is extremely aggressive, then this razor if for you. With time and techniques you can eliminate the nicks and get a very good shave.
